QR Codes for Apartment Leasing
From "Now Leasing" banner to booked tour, without a phone call.
Most prospects see your "Now Leasing" banner from a car window, and almost none of them will call the number on it. A QR code on the banner, yard signs, and unit-door flyers gives them the action they actually want: scan, see floor plans and real pricing, book a tour for Saturday. Inside, a code at the model unit opens the application while the granite countertops are still doing the selling. Dynamic codes carry the property through its lifecycle - lease-up specials today, waitlist next year - on the same printed banners.
Why use a dynamic QR code for this
Tours booked from the sidewalk
The banner code opens your scheduling page - prospects book while they're parked outside, not after they've seen three other buildings.
Answers at the unit door
Door flyers open that unit's floor plan, photos, and availability - fewer repetitive questions, better-qualified tours.
Banners that outlive the special
Repoint the same code from move-in special to standard pricing to waitlist as occupancy changes - banners are expensive, links are free.

FAQ
Can each unit have its own code?
Yes, and it's worth it: a code per unit or floor plan means the door flyer opens exactly the right page, and scan counts show which units draw interest.
What happens to the codes when the building is full?
Repoint them at a waitlist form. The banners keep collecting demand for the next vacancy instead of advertising apartments you don't have.
Can I change where the QR code points after printing?
Yes - with a dynamic QR code. It encodes a short redirect link, so you can update the destination anytime from your dashboard and every printed copy instantly points to the new URL. Static codes encode the destination directly and can't be changed.
